English[edit]

Etymology[edit]

dimwitted +‎ -ly

Adverb[edit]

dimwittedly (comparative more dimwittedly, superlative most dimwittedly)

  1. In a dimwitted or stupid manner.
    • 2012 October 4, Jon Caramanica, “Chicago Hip-Hop’s Raw Burst of Change”, in The New York Times[1], →ISSN:
      Pitchfork dimwittedly chose to interview him at a gun range; following the Lil Jojo murder, it removed the interview from its Web site and apologized.
